1-Day Adventure in Santiago de Compostela

1-Day Adventure in Santiago de Compostela Itinerary

Last updated: 2024 Jun 14

Exploring Santiago's Rich Heritage

Morning
Start your day with a visit to the Cathedral of Santiago de Compostela (Catedral de Santiago de Compostela). This iconic landmark is not only a masterpiece of Romanesque architecture but also the final destination of the Camino de Santiago pilgrimage. Take your time to explore its stunning interiors and the famous Botafumeiro, a giant thurible used during special ceremonies. Afterward, enjoy a delightful breakfast at Café Tertulia, known for its cozy atmosphere and delicious pastries.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, head to the Monastery of San Martiño Pinario (Mosteiro de San Martiño Pinario). This impressive monastery is one of the largest in Spain and offers a glimpse into the region's religious history. Wander through its peaceful cloisters and admire the intricate Baroque details. For lunch, visit O Gato Negro, a highly-rated local restaurant renowned for its traditional Galician dishes.
Evening
Conclude your day with a stroll through Praza das Praterías (Plaza de Platerías), one of the most charming squares in Santiago. The square is surrounded by historic buildings and features a beautiful fountain at its center. As evening falls, indulge in some authentic Galician tapas at Abastos 2.0, a popular spot that combines modern culinary techniques with traditional flavors.
